What is a Cloud Platform?

A cloud platform is a virtual environment hosted over the internet that allows businesses to store, manage, and process data and applications. It eliminates the need for physical hardware in some cases, providing a scalable and flexible infrastructure on demand. Cloud platforms are typically categorized into three service models.

Infrastructure as a Service (IaaS)

Provides virtualized computing resources over the internet. Users can rent servers, storage, and networking on a pay-as-you-go basis. Examples include Microsoft Azure, AWS, and Google Cloud.

Platform as a Service (PaaS)

Offers a platform allowing developers to build, run, and manage applications without worrying about underlying infrastructure. Examples include Heroku and Google App Engine.

Software as a Service (SaaS)

Provides software applications over the internet. Users access the software via web browsers, eliminating the need for installation and management of the software itself. Examples include Salesforce, Microsoft Office 365, and Dropbox.

Types of Cloud Platforms

Cloud platforms come in several types, each suited to different business needs.

Public cloud platforms, such as AWS and Microsoft Azure, are owned and operated by third-party providers and offer scalable resources over the internet, ideal for businesses seeking cost-effective, flexible solutions.

Private cloud platforms, on the other hand, are dedicated to a single organization, providing enhanced control over data and security, but often at a higher cost.

Hybrid cloud solutions combine both public and private clouds, allowing businesses to balance sensitive data storage with cost-effective scalability, offering the best of both worlds.

Finally, multi-cloud strategies involve using multiple cloud providers, which helps avoid vendor lock-in and allows businesses to optimize workloads by taking advantage of the unique strengths of different platforms.

Each of these options has its own advantages and trade-offs, making it essential to align cloud platform choices with a company’s specific needs.

Public Cloud

A public cloud environment is one owned and operated by third-party providers that deliver services over the internet.

Pros

  • Cost-effective as users pay only for what they use.
  • Highly scalable, allowing businesses to increase or decrease resources as needed.
  • Maintenance and security updates are handled by the provider.

Cons

  • Less control over security as the infrastructure is shared with other users.
  • Compliance challenges for industries with strict regulations.

Ideal for: Startups and businesses with variable workloads.

Private Cloud

A private cloud environment is dedicated to a single organization, either hosted on-premises or by a third-party provider.

Pros

  • Complete control over data, security, and compliance.
  • Customizable to meet specific business needs.

Cons

  • Higher costs due to the need for dedicated infrastructure.
  • Limited scalability compared to public clouds.

Ideal for: Enterprises that handle sensitive data or have strict regulatory requirements.

Hybrid Cloud

A hybrid cloud system is a combination of public and private clouds and on-premises systems, allowing data and applications to be shared between them.

Pros

  • Flexibility to optimize where applications and data are stored based on business needs.
  • Cost-effective, using public cloud for non-sensitive tasks and private cloud for sensitive data.

Cons

  • Increased complexity in managing both environments.
  • Limited scalability compared to public clouds.

Ideal for: Organizations looking to balance performance, costs, and security.

Multi-Cloud

A Multi-Cloud system uses two or more cloud services from different providers, often including both public and private clouds.

Pros

  • Avoids vendor lock-in by using multiple providers.
  • Can optimize workloads by using the strengths of different platforms.

Cons

  • Complex integration and management between different cloud services.

Ideal for: Large enterprises with diverse workloads requiring different solutions.

Benefits of Cloud Platforms

Scalability

Cloud platforms allow businesses to scale resources up or down based on demand. This is crucial for handling variable workloads, such as peak traffic during a sales event or holiday season.

Cost Efficiency

By adopting a cloud platform, businesses avoid the need for costly hardware investments. The pay-as-you-go model ensures that companies only pay for what they use, making it more cost-efficient than maintaining on-premise infrastructure.

Performance and Reliability

Cloud providers offer high availability with built-in redundancy and disaster recovery options. This ensures that systems remain operational even if hardware fails or there are other unexpected disruptions.

Security

While security remains a concern, especially with public clouds, most cloud platforms offer advanced security features like encryption, firewalls, and multi-factor authentication. Some providers also ensure compliance with industry standards.

Innovation and Speed

Cloud platforms provide development teams with access to the latest tools, software, and capabilities, such as AI, machine learning, and big data analytics, enabling faster innovation and product development cycles.

Key Considerations

Cost Management

Monitoring resource usage is critical to avoid unnecessary charges. Many businesses encounter "cloud sprawl," where unmanaged resources accumulate, leading to cost overruns.

Workload Assessment

Not all workloads benefit equally from being moved to the cloud. A proper assessment of which workloads to migrate and which to keep on-premises can prevent inefficiencies and extra costs.

Security and Compliance

Cloud platforms handle security differently than on-premise solutions. Understanding these differences and ensuring compliance with regulations is essential to avoid penalties or data breaches.

Exit Strategy

Organizations should plan for the possibility of moving data or workloads between cloud providers or back on-premises to avoid vendor lock-in.

Reasons Why You May Have To Consider Repatriation

Security Concerns

For businesses handling sensitive or highly regulated data, security in the cloud can sometimes be a concern. While cloud providers offer strong security measures, some organizations may feel more secure having complete control over their data by bringing it back in-house.

Compliance and Regulatory Requirements

Some industries, such as healthcare and finance, are subject to stringent regulatory requirements regarding where and how data is stored. In certain cases, organizations may find that maintaining compliance is easier or less risky by repatriating data to systems they fully control.

Cost Management

As cloud usage grows, so can the associated costs, especially when organizations fail to optimize their resources. For long-term data storage or intensive applications, repatriating certain workloads can reduce ongoing operational expenses.

Vendor Lock-In

Relying on a single cloud provider can pose risks if the vendor changes pricing structures or service levels. Repatriating data can give organizations more flexibility and control, avoiding dependency on one provider.

A Solid Plan Should Include These Items

Clear Criteria

Define the specific reasons and conditions under which repatriation will occur, whether driven by security concerns, compliance needs, or cost factors.

Data Classification

Ensure that your data is properly classified and understood before moving it, so you know which workloads or datasets are best suited for repatriation.

Technical Considerations

Plan for the technical challenges of moving data, such as bandwidth requirements, storage infrastructure, and ensuring minimal downtime.

Testing and Validation

Test the repatriation process beforehand to identify potential issues, ensuring data integrity and operational stability during the transition.

Factors to Weigh Before Selection

Data Strategy

Define the types of data that need to be stored, processed, and analyzed. Not all data may benefit from cloud migration, and some may be better kept in private or on-premise systems.

Compliance and Regulatory Requirements

Ensure that the cloud platform meets the compliance needs of your industry. Some public cloud environments may not offer the necessary guarantees for industries like healthcare or finance.

Integration

Ensure that the chosen platform integrates well with your existing systems and software. This includes ensuring compatibility with applications, APIs, and databases.

Vendor Reputation and Service Level Agreements (SLAs)

Evaluate the reliability and reputation of cloud providers. SLAs should guarantee uptime and performance standards that meet your business needs.
